1. Tinder is a location-based dating app with 50 million users that matches people anonymously who swipe right on each other's profiles. 2. It was founded in 2012 and has had some leadership changes and a sexual harassment lawsuit, but now has Sean Rad back as CEO. 3. The app is monetized through Tinder Plus subscriptions and ads, and had $75 million in revenues in 2015, with reported valuations between $1.2-1.6 billion.
